Experiencing fluctuations in organic traffic and rankings? Columnist Stephanie LeVonne has a list of factors to check and how to address them.
The post 10 factors that may be impacting your organic traffic appeared first on Search Engine Land.
Please visit Search Engine Land for the full article.
Source: Search Engine Land
Link: 10 factors that may be impacting your organic traffic
Leave a Reply